Dawn Brancheau Foundation

The family of Dawn Brancheau, the Killer Whale trainer tragically killed at SeaWorld Orlando earlier this year, has started a foundation in her memory. The Dawn Brancheau Foundation , as you might expect, supports the things that Brancheau was involved in in her life, organizations like Make-A-Wish, SPCTA, and other community organizations. In their short existence, they were officially established on Oct 14th, they have organized volunteer efforts at Give Kid The World and funded a soccer field in the Congo.

Disney Tattoo Guy Selling Collection

Say it ain’t so George! According to a story in the Philadelphia Inquirer George Reiger, known to Disney fans everywhere as the Disney Tattoo Guy, is selling his 5,000 piece collection of Disneyana for a new love. Some items in his collection are amazingly rare or even unique one of a kind pieces. So there will be some lucky fans out there.
